摘要

Modern communication standards are constantly evolving. The main challenge in the wireless industry is to provide hardware requirements for supporting the various evolving standards and protocols to facilitate the services to end users. In such an environment, Software Defined Radio is gaining popularity. Most of the wireless standards are computationally complex and it is challenging to map them on to an architecture, with minimum resources and higher energy efficiency. This paper discusses the design of receiver structure for a software radio, using polyphase channelizer. The paper mainly focuses on the design of Frequency Modulation (FM) channelizer as a case study. Hardware complexity analysis and comparison of the channelizer for various polyphase filter structure implementations is also presented. Simulation results for polyphase channelizer are also discussed in this work.
